Saturday, June 11, 1960
MRS. ETTA ISBELL MITCHELL, 84, died Friday morning at her home in Martin following a heart attack.
She was born at Mize, a daughter of the late Charlie and Lizzie Dickson Isbell and had lived in Stephens and Franklin Counties most of her life.
She was the widow of H. T. Mitchell and was a member of Liberty Hill Baptist Church. She was an honorary member of the Martin Woman's Club.
Survivors include two daughters, Miss Sarah Mitchell and Miss Clarice Mitchell both of the home; a sister, Mrs. L. F. Taylor of Orlando, FL and a number of nieces and nephews.
Funeral services will be conducted at 3 P.M. Sunday from the Martin Baptist Church with Rev. Marvin Willis and Rev. H. E. Doud officiating. Burial will be in Liberty Hill Bapt. Church Cemetery.
Pallbearers: Doyle Land, Floyd Stowe, John Goodwin, Elmer Freeman, Kell Mitchell and Mose Thomas.
Mathews Mortuary, Toccoa, GA.
